Why AI matters at this scale

The United States Army Special Operations Command (USASOC) is the premier special operations force of the U.S. Army, responsible for organizing, training, equipping, and deploying specialized units like the Green Berets and Rangers for global missions. With over 10,000 personnel and a multi-billion-dollar budget, USASOC operates at the tip of the spear in counterterrorism, unconventional warfare, and sensitive special reconnaissance. At this scale and mission-critical nature, AI is not merely an efficiency tool but a strategic imperative to maintain overmatch against adversaries who are also rapidly adopting AI. The sheer volume of data from intelligence, surveillance, and reconnaissance (ISR) platforms, combined with the need for split-second decisions in complex environments, makes AI-enabled automation and augmentation essential for preserving operational advantage and force protection.

Concrete AI Opportunities with ROI Framing

1. Predictive Intelligence and Mission Planning: By applying machine learning to fused intelligence data—from signals intercepts to satellite imagery—USASOC can transition from reactive to predictive operations. AI models can identify patterns indicating imminent threats or operational opportunities, allowing for proactive force deployment. The ROI is measured in enhanced mission success rates, reduced casualty risks, and more efficient allocation of high-demand ISR assets, directly translating multi-million-dollar investments into preserved strategic initiative.

2. Autonomous and Swarming ISR Systems: Deploying AI-enabled unmanned aerial and ground vehicles for reconnaissance reduces the exposure of human operators to hostile fire. Machine learning algorithms allow these systems to navigate denied environments, classify targets, and relay information autonomously. The financial return comes from lowering the cost per hour of persistent surveillance compared to manned platforms and mitigating the immense financial and human cost of losing personnel or traditional aircraft.

3. AI-Enhanced Training and Readiness: Generative AI can create dynamic, immersive training simulations that adapt in real-time to trainee decisions, replicating the fog and friction of real-world missions. This synthetic training environment accelerates proficiency for complex tasks like hostage rescue or foreign internal defense. The ROI is clear: it reduces the logistical cost and scheduling constraints of large-scale live exercises while producing better-prepared operators, thereby decreasing the likelihood of costly mission failures.

Deployment Risks Specific to Large Defense Organizations

For an organization of USASOC's size and sensitivity, AI deployment carries unique risks. Integration with Legacy Systems is a monumental challenge, as new AI tools must interface with decades-old command and control infrastructure, requiring significant custom middleware and sustained funding. Data Sovereignty and Security is paramount; training AI models on highly classified operational datasets necessitates air-gapped, on-premises infrastructure or specially accredited government clouds, limiting the use of commercial off-the-shelf SaaS. Ethical and Legal Governance around lethal autonomous weapons and bias in targeting algorithms requires robust oversight frameworks to maintain public trust and comply with international law, potentially slowing deployment cycles. Finally, Talent Acquisition in a tight labor market means competing with Silicon Valley for top AI engineers, often requiring reliance on system integrators and defense contractors, which can increase costs and reduce internal expertise.
